Okay, so I finally installed this hot water recirculating pump after reading mixed reviews. Here's my real-deal experience:
First off, the INSTANT HOT WATER claim? Not *instant* instant, but way faster than before. My shower used to take forever to warm up—now it's like 10 seconds max. Game changer for winter mornings!
The TIMER feature is genius but kinda quirky. Mine gains about 10 minutes daily (not 15 like some said). I just reset it weekly while making coffee—no biggie.
Sound level? SHOCKINGLY quiet. Like, my fridge is louder. The negative reviews about noise must've gotten lemons because mine hums softer than my AC.
Installation was... an adventure. PSA: It DOESN'T come with sensor valves (learned that mid-install). Had to make a hardware store run, but YouTube tutorials saved me.
Water savings are REAL though. No more watching gallons go down the drain waiting for warmth. My utility bill dropped enough to notice.
Final verdict? 4/5 stars—loses one for the missing parts headache. But now that it's working? Absolute lifesaver when you've got a house full of impatient shower-takers!
